About Randi A. Schea

Randi A. Schea is a scholar working on Oncology, Pulmonary and Respiratory Medicine, Molecular Biology, Obstetrics and Gynecology and Radiology, Nuclear Medicine and Imaging, having authored 8 papers that have together received 150 indexed citations. Recurring topics across this work include Lung Cancer Research Studies (5 papers), Lung Cancer Treatments and Mutations (3 papers), Brain Metastases and Treatment (2 papers), Lung Cancer Diagnosis and Treatment (2 papers), Endometrial and Cervical Cancer Treatments (1 paper), Lanthanide and Transition Metal Complexes (1 paper), Protease and Inhibitor Mechanisms (1 paper) and Heat shock proteins research (1 paper). The work is most often cited by research in Obstetrics and Gynecology (50 citations), Radiation (14 citations), Pulmonary and Respiratory Medicine (47 citations), Reproductive Medicine (12 citations) and Oncology (32 citations). Randi A. Schea has collaborated with scholars based in United States and France. Frequent co-authors include James H. Ellis, James A. Roberts, Mark L. Lavigne, Sonja L. Schoeppel, Pamela K. Allen, Ritsuko Komaki, Luka Milas, Mark Meyers, J. S. Lee and Heather L. Burrows. Their work appears in journals such as International Journal of Radiation Oncology*Biology*Physics, Radiology and PubMed.
